Output 61a606d4bd3bc260434297de94015b59c946a41b84dc031ec8c81cafa0bc0e0d:1

value
84740000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fca7a8d7553d0440488b31a7fd277bc0cce2d87 OP_EQUALVERIFY OP_CHECKSIG
address
1KwhSBGf1A8Y7nDD3uBhsxxWv5Xv7cnQu2
transaction
61a606d4bd3bc260434297de94015b59c946a41b84dc031ec8c81cafa0bc0e0d
confirmations
529139
spent
true